All About the Edmonton Folk Music Festival (August 10 - 13)

The Edmonton Folk Music Festival is an annual event held in the picturesque downtown Gallagher Park of Edmonton, Alberta, Canada from August 10th -13th. This enchanting festival takes place every year on the second weekend in August, bringing together music enthusiasts from near and far. Here is everything you need to know about the Edmonton Folk Music Festival. 

The festival was first conceived in 1980 by a group of passionate music lovers who sought to create a platform for folk artists to showcase their talent and connect with audiences. The festival has since evolved into a world-class event, attracting renowned musicians and emerging talents alike. 

Attendees can expect a harmonious blend of traditional folk tunes, soul-stirring ballads, lively bluegrass melodies, and captivating world music rhythms. The festival's commitment to showcasing both established and emerging artists ensures a fresh and exciting musical experience for all.

In addition to the world-class folk music performances, the festival boasts a vibrant food scene with numerous food vendors serving a diverse range of international delicacies. For those looking to relax and unwind, a lively beer garden offers a selection of refreshing brews to complement the spirited singing and ensure a memorable experience for all attendees.

The Edmonton Folk Music Festival is perfect for families, as children aged eleven and under can enter for free. Beyond that, it serves as a community-driven event, powered by the passion of over 2,500 dedicated volunteers. Their mission is to deliver the finest folk music from around the world to Northern Alberta, all while ensuring an atmosphere brimming with fun and excitement.

The festival also hosts workshops and interactive sessions where artists share their craft and engage with the audience, fostering a deeper appreciation for folk music.
